Granted
The Board granted service connection for diabetes mellitus type II, based on the Veteran's presumed exposure to herbicide agents during his service in or near the Korean Demilitarized Zone.
The deciding factor: Service connection was granted due to reasonable doubt being resolved in favor of the Veteran and presumptive service connection applying given his claimed exposure to herbicide agents while serving in or near the DMZ.
